Linux环境监控工具汇总
- Linux 操作系统有诸多自带和第三方的监控工具,以下从不同维度来整理常用的一些监控工具。
CPU
- top(经典的Linux任务管理工具)
示例:top -n 1 -b
示例:top -n 1 -b
一、缓存的重要性 无论是用于存储用户数据的索引,还是各种系统数据,都是以页的形式存放在表空间中的。 所谓表空间,只不过是InnoDB对一个或几个实际文件的抽象。也就是说,我们的数据说到底还是存储在磁盘上的。 但是磁盘读取速度很慢,所以如果需要访问某个页的数据时,InnoDB会把完整的页中的数据全部加载到内存中。即使只需要访问一个页里面的一条记录,也需要先把整个页的数据加载到内存中。然后就可以在内存
在多写(多节点写入)数据库(例如MySQL MGR的multi-primary mode)与应用之间,往往会加一层代理组件,通过算法调节不同节点负载,分发高并发读写请求。 要求代理工具需要具有请求转发、负载均衡、故障转移的功能。 在后端节点故障发生或者连接因为客户端异常、网络问题断开时,需要及时将故障节点及时踢出负载均衡队列或者关闭异常连接,做到故障转移。 这就是接下来介绍的主要内容,使用gola
MySQL 8.0 在引入新的功能和配置参数的同时,也开始废弃一些配置参数,被标记为废弃的参数,将在以后的版本被完全移除,在移除之前,这些参数仍然可以使用,但是不再建议使用。
1、并发控制 mysql 数据库 同一时间会有多个用户一起使用 1.1 锁机制 加锁是为了限制别人的操作,不会影响自己。 锁类型: 读锁:共享锁,也称为 S 锁,只读不可写(包括当前事务) ,多个读互不阻塞 只能读 不能写 别人也能看 写锁:独占锁,排它锁,也称为 X 锁,写锁会阻塞其它事务(不包括当前事务)的读和写 写锁 别人不可读也不可写 S 锁和 S 锁是兼容的,X 锁和其它锁都不兼容, 锁
GreatSQL社区原创内容未经授权不得随意使用,转载请联系小编并注明来源。 GreatSQL是MySQL的国产分支版本,使用上与MySQL一致。 作者:叶金荣 文章来源:GreatSQL社区原创 问题缘起 同事在客户现场利用DTS工具,从A实例将数据迁移到B实例过程中,发现几乎稍大点的表在迁移完成后,目标端表空间大小差不多都是源端的3倍,也就是说表空间膨胀了2倍。 排查思路 对这篇文章 《叶问》